- Under 18s must be accompanied by their parents or legal guardians.
- The park does not accept breeds/crossbreeds listed in the Breed-specific legislation (i.e. Pit Bull Terrier, Japanese Tosa, Dogo Argentino, and Fila Brasileiro).
- Group bookings of 3 or more units (e.g. tent, caravan, RV or accommodation hire) traveling together are not permitted via Pitchup.com.
- Single-sex bookings of 3 or more people (couples and immediate family members excepted) are not permitted via Pitchup.com.
- No bachelor/bachelorette parties permitted via Pitchup.com.
- Facilities/activities including launderette are subject to extra charges payable on arrival.
- Commercial vehicles (vehicles used for work-related purposes, carrying goods or fare-paying passengers) and sign-written vehicles are not permitted on site.
- The park caters for families (immediate members) and couples only - bookings from all other forms of groups are not accepted.
- A cable measuring at least 25 metres is needed for the electric hook-ups.

- When can I check in and check out of Stratford Racecourse Touring Park?
RV, travel trailer and tent sites Arrive: noon – 6 p.m. Depart by: 11 a.m. On race days the campsite may require you to vacate your pitch by 10.30am.
